How to Set Up Mandarin to Spanish Live Translation
Start by downloading Seagull on your Mac, Windows, or Linux desktop and launching the application. Once open, select Mandarin as your source language and Spanish as your target language from the 60+ language options. The app immediately begins listening to your system audio, so you do not need to configure microphones or route audio through external tools.
Open the application or content you want to translate, whether that is a video call, YouTube video, or audio file playing in another program. Seagull's floating subtitle panel will appear on top of your screen, updating in real time as speech is detected. For two-way conversations, activate Conversation Mode to translate your Spanish responses back to Mandarin, creating a full translation pipeline for both speakers.
Tips for Accurate Mandarin to Spanish Translation
Position your subtitle overlay in a spot where it does not block important UI elements or speaker faces. Keep your screen at a comfortable brightness level so subtitles remain readable during video calls. If audio quality is poor or background noise is high, consider using a better microphone or closing unnecessary applications to reduce competing sounds.
Mandarin tones and Spanish pronunciation differences occasionally cause mistranslations, especially with names, technical terms, or slang. Always verify critical information by asking the speaker to repeat if the subtitle seems off. Avoid relying solely on translation for legal, medical, or highly technical content where human review is essential.
